  2. 3 dni temu · What is Mileage Reimbursement? Mileage reimbursement is the sum payable by the company to their field employee they bore while travelling in their personal vehicle for business purposes. One thing to note, the claims don’t involve mileage incurred to travel to and fro from the office or any personal commute.

  4. 5 dni temu · Cents-per-mile (CPM) Reimbursement. The CPM method allows for completely tax-free reimbursements as long the reimbursements are at or below the standard IRS mileage rate, (67 cents per mile in 2024).
